Proud Dad Brags Again

by Frank Paynter on August 18, 2006

Turn to the Contributors page (page 78) of the September, 2006 issue of Details magazine and you’ll see a blurb about Ben Paynter’s article (found on page 198) “Weapons of Mass Distraction.” It’s a story about the distracting influence of internet access on American soldiers in Iraq. No longer does a “Dear John” letter or a foreclosure notice take days and weeks to find its way to the GI at the front. Now the guys just log on and get the news directly as it’s happening back home.

The Details biographical blurb on Ben says,

Paynter writes for the Pitch, a weekly in Kansas City, Missouri. A story of his will appear in Best American Sports Writing 2006, out next month from Houghton Mifflin.
